Freehold Township 13, Howell, 10

Junior Gianna Neron scored a career-high 6 goals to lift Freehold Township (6-1, 4-0) past district rival Howell (3-3, 2-2). Senior Chloe Walters and Alyssa Costagliola each sank 3 goals. Freshman Brook Jenkins also scored a goal while junior Maddie Reiser tallied an assist. Junior goalie Araiana Hopper turned back 7 shots in the win for the Patriots.

Senior Sophia Schwark scored 3 goals in the loss for the Rebels. Juniors Kendall Bleakley and Ava Brandt each added 2 goals. Sophomore Makenzie Memmolo finished with 1 goal.

Manchester 7, Jackson Liberty 3

A strong defensive performance and 3 goals from senior Riley McGuire helped Manchester (6-2, 6-0) stave off Jackson Liberty (0-6, 0-4) to remain undefeated in divisional play. Junior Isabella Erli added 2 goals and 1 assist. Senior Nahiaranette scored 1 goal and sophomore Shae O’Neill scored her first career goal. Junior Alexa Wnek distributed a team-high 2 assists while sophomores Ava Kennedy and Zoey Rodriguez also tallied an assist. Sophomore goalie Elizabeth Grausso turned away 3 shots in the win for the Hawks. While not yet set in stone, a potential division championship match-up with New Egypt could be on the horizon in 2 weeks.

 

New Egypt 10, Monmouth 5

Junior Madison Adam matched her career-high for goals in a game with 9 and added an assist to guide New Egypt (5-0, 5-0) past Monmouth (4-4, 2-2). Adam’s second goal of the day gave her 200 for her career and she now sits at 207. Junior Aimee Kovacs added the other goal and freshman goalie Corinne Ring recorded 2 saves in the win for the Warriors. It is becoming increasingly likely that the May 1st match-up between New Egypt and Manchester will be for the Independence Division title as both teams remain undefeated within divisional play.

Barnegat 14, Lacey 7

Ella Tortorici, Emilia Ercolino, and Molly Carrol scored 3 goals a piece, and Coach Lyndsey Torre earned her 100th victory, as Barnegat defeated Lacey 14-7 in a non-divisional matchup.  Lizzie Medina and Sadie Guiro added 2 goals each for Barnegat (5-2)

Lacey’s leading scorer Zoey Smith had 3 first period goals for Lacey (2-3) but Barnegat’s defense completely shut her down for the final three periods.  Giana Camporeale scored 2 goals for Lacey, and freshman Emily Slota scored 2 goals and won 16 draw controls for the Lions.

No. 1 Rumson-Fair Haven 12, Haddonfield 9

A career-high 5 goal scoring performance from senior Mia Milkowski guided Rumson-Fair Haven (4-3) past South Jersey power Haddonfield (5-2). Senior Daisen Iwan and sophomore Chloe Kelly each added 2 goals. Seniors Rachel James and Sophie Yockel as well as sophomore Aly Megaw each scored 1 goal. The Rumson defense did a stellar job of limiting Princeton commit Grace Farrell who has 236 career points to just 1 goal.
